Getting ready in Fulham and East London
Camilla got ready at her family home in Fulham. She spent a relaxed morning with her bridesmaids and family. Camilla’s mum had decorated the house and garden with beautiful blooms. Camilla put her dress on in her childhood bedroom. I always think it’s really lovely to spend time in a place that really means something special to you, on the morning of your wedding.
An adventure through the streets of East London
My second shooter, Jo, headed over to East London to meet James and the boys. James really wanted to have some portraits taken against the backdrop of East London graffiti where he lives. After taking some shots with some of the amazing Shoreditch murals, they all jumped on the tube to head over to Chelsea for the wedding ceremony.
The wedding ceremony at Chelsea Old Church
The church ceremony was held at Chelsea Old Church and James and Camilla grinned all the way through. After vows were exchanged James and Camilla jumped in their beautiful vintage wedding car and we headed over to Mayfair, to take some pictures around Dartmouth House before their guests joined us.
A Dartmouth House wedding reception and party
Guests arrived on red Routemaster buses, and joined James and Camilla for their drinks reception. A three-piece band played in the lobby, as guests drank champagne and ate Canapés. I whisked Camilla and James out to take some creative portraits around Mayfair. We found some pretty mews houses and enjoyed a walk through the Mayfair streets.
Guests sat down to dinner and speeches, then James and Camilla cut their cake and led guests through to the party, where they kicked things off with their choreographed first dance. They partied the rest of the night away to Capitale.
